Card payments remain the backbone of WooCommerce checkouts. These plugins bring new payment rails (cards, Apple Pay, Klarna) with fraud controls and conversions in mind.

What to prioritize

  • Multiple gateways: Offer Stripe, PayPal, Klarna, and local methods.
  • Tokenization: Store cards for future subscriptions or wallet top-ups.
  • Smart checkout: Embedded buttons, accelerated flows, and autopay options.

1. WooPayments

★★★★★ 4.8/5, Editor’s Rating

WooPayments is the official payment solution built into WooCommerce. It handles credit cards, debit cards, Apple Pay, Google Pay, and buy-now-pay-later options with no third-party redirect.

Key Features

  • Accept cards, Apple Pay, Google Pay, and Klarna
  • Manage payments from the WooCommerce dashboard
  • Built-in fraud protection and dispute handling
  • Multi-currency support for international stores

Pricing: Free plugin. Transaction fees: 2.9% + $0.30 per transaction.

3. Stripe Payment Gateway for WooCommerce

★★★★☆ 4.6/5, Editor’s Rating

The official Stripe gateway plugin for WooCommerce. It supports credit cards, debit cards, and Stripe’s full suite of payment methods including SEPA, iDEAL, and Bancontact.

Key Features

  • Credit and debit card processing via Stripe
  • Apple Pay and Google Pay support
  • Saved cards for returning customers
  • 3D Secure authentication for fraud prevention

Pricing: Free plugin. Stripe fees: 2.9% + $0.30 per transaction.

4. PayPal Payments for WooCommerce

★★★★☆ 4.5/5, Editor’s Rating

PayPal Payments is the official PayPal plugin for WooCommerce. It accepts PayPal, Venmo, credit cards, and debit cards with smart payment buttons that adapt to the shopper.

Key Features

  • PayPal, Venmo, and card payments in one plugin
  • Smart payment buttons that show relevant options
  • Pay Later installment options
  • One-touch checkout for returning PayPal users

Pricing: Free plugin. PayPal fees: 2.99% + $0.49 per transaction.

5. Square for WooCommerce

★★★★☆ 4.4/5, Editor’s Rating

Square for WooCommerce syncs your online and in-person sales. It processes card payments and keeps inventory in sync between your WooCommerce store and Square POS terminal.

Key Features

  • Card processing with Square gateway
  • Inventory sync between online and POS
  • Supports digital wallets and contactless payments
  • Automatic product and order syncing

Pricing: Free plugin. Square fees: 2.9% + $0.30 per transaction.

6. Authorize.Net for WooCommerce

★★★★☆ 4.3/5, Editor’s Rating

Authorize.Net gateway connects WooCommerce to one of the oldest and most trusted payment processors. It handles credit cards, eChecks, and recurring billing.

Key Features

  • Credit card and eCheck processing
  • Tokenized card storage for subscriptions
  • Advanced fraud detection suite
  • Detailed transaction reporting

Pricing: Plugin from $79/year. Authorize.Net: $25/month + 2.9% + $0.30.

7. Braintree for WooCommerce

★★★★☆ 4.2/5, Editor’s Rating

Braintree (a PayPal service) processes credit cards, PayPal, Venmo, and digital wallets through a single integration. It offers a clean checkout experience with drop-in UI.

Key Features

  • Cards, PayPal, Venmo, and Apple Pay in one gateway
  • Drop-in checkout UI with hosted fields
  • Vault for saved payment methods
  • 3D Secure 2.0 for fraud prevention

Pricing: Free plugin. Braintree fees: 2.59% + $0.49 per transaction.

8. Mollie Payments for WooCommerce

★★★★☆ 4.1/5, Editor’s Rating

Mollie supports cards, iDEAL, Bancontact, SEPA, Klarna, and more. It is popular with European stores that need local payment methods alongside standard card processing.

Key Features

  • 20+ payment methods including European local options
  • No monthly fees, pay per transaction only
  • Recurring payments for subscriptions
  • Real-time payment status updates

Pricing: Free plugin. Mollie fees vary by method, cards from 1.8% + EUR 0.25.

9. Amazon Pay for WooCommerce

★★★★☆ 4.0/5, Editor’s Rating

Amazon Pay lets shoppers use their Amazon account to pay on your WooCommerce store. It pulls saved addresses and payment methods from their Amazon profile for a fast checkout.

Key Features

  • Checkout with Amazon account credentials
  • Pre-filled shipping address from Amazon
  • Fraud protection backed by Amazon
  • Works with WooCommerce subscriptions

Pricing: Free plugin. Amazon Pay fees: 2.9% + $0.30 per transaction.

10. Worldpay for WooCommerce

★★★☆☆ 3.9/5, Editor’s Rating

Worldpay processes card payments for businesses in 146 countries. It handles Visa, Mastercard, Amex, and local card networks with PCI DSS Level 1 compliance.

Key Features

  • Global card processing in 146 countries
  • Supports all major card networks
  • PCI DSS Level 1 compliant
  • Recurring billing for subscriptions

Pricing: Custom pricing based on business volume. Contact Worldpay for a quote.
